Net Zero: A Blueprint for Global Sustainability is an in-depth exploration of the progress, opportunities, pathways, and challenges in achieving net-zero emissions to control climate change and global warming issues. It stands as a groundbreaking and comprehensive guide in the realm of climate action literature, traversing the intricate landscape of climate change mitigation and focusing on the imperative of achieving net-zero emissions globally. This book scrutinizes both the technological facets of achieving net-zero emissions, such as advancements in renewable energy and carbon capture and storage technologies, and also delves into the socio-economic and ethical dimensions. It will also focus on the importance of achieving net-zero emissions globally by covering a wide range of industries, including business, chemical, manufacturing, aviation, heat, electricity, building, and power sectors.
- Equips readers with a holistic understanding of Net Zero's potential for climate resilience and sustainable progress
- Provides readers with practical and relevant information, enabling them to implement effective strategies for achieving net-zero emissions
- Examines emerging trends, future outlooks, and anticipated technological advancements in the realm of net-zero emissions
